Manchester Community Music School is a non-profit organization committed to the mission of “changing lives through the power of learning, sharing, and making music.” Located in historic north Manchester, MCMS provides quality musical instruction, music therapy, and performance opportunities for people of all ages. The Music School is home to 50 of New England’s finest music educators and music therapists and over 1,500 students and clients from across New Hampshire. As a cultural performance center, we offer programs in an environment that encourages participation, interaction, and enjoyment. We are dedicated to supporting the artistic development of the community through our programs, and our classes are open to all regardless of age, race, national origin, physical challenges, or ability to pay.
Manchester Community Music School is seeking a part-time staff Collaborative Pianist. The Collaborative Pianist is responsible for serving as the accompanist for the MCMS Women’s Choir, MCMS Queen City Voices Choir, and MCMS Queen City Concert Choir. They will also be responsible for accompanying students in 2 pre-scheduled MCMS adult recitals a year (January 12th, 2026, and May 18th, 2026). There will be the opportunity to accompany students or faculty members for additional recitals, events, and competitions (right of first refusal).
Position begins December 4th, 2025, and runs through June 13th, 2026. Bulk of hours needed will be late afternoon or evening in December, January, February, May, and June.
